Idaho National Laboratory is hiring an Electrical Engineer to work on our Electrical Controls and Structural Engineering team.
Our team works a 4x10 schedule located out of our Materials and Fuels Complex (MFC) with every Friday off.
This position is located at our Materials and Fuels Complex, which hosts the core of the U.S. nuclear research and development capabilities with a diverse array of facilities designed for remote work on highly irradiated fuels and materials.
A new fuel idea can be designed, fabricated, tested, and analyzed at MFC to better understand the effects of irradiation.
Many groups, such as universities, industry partners, other national laboratories, international research organizations, and other federal agencies are working at MFC.
You will apply engineering principles to electrical systems and electrical power transmission and distribution.
Apply electrical engineering theories and principles to explore research opportunities associated with electrical energy generation, storage, transmission, distribution, management, and use.
Collaborate with associated engineering professions to ensure the development of integrated systems to enable safe, resilient, reliable delivery of power to the end user.
